The lens varies from both the optometrist as well as ophthalmologist in that they are not enabled to detect or treat an eye illness. An optician is a technician that was informed to make, confirm and appropriately fit both the structures and lenses of glasses, call lenses, as well as various other eye dealing with gadgets.

Ophthalmologists have either a Medical Professional of Medicine (MD) level or a Physician of Osteopathy (DO) degree before they finish four years of ophthalmology residency. They are "eye MD's" as well as ophthalmologic specialists who deal with all illness and also disorders of the eyes.
